Japan Metal Anti-Seize Lubricant Market Insights Application of Japan Metal Anti-Seize Lubricant Market The Japan Metal Anti-Seize Lubricant Market finds extensive application across various industries, including automotive, manufacturing, aerospace, and energy sectors. It is primarily used to prevent galling, seizing, and corrosion on threaded fasteners, bolts, and nuts, especially under high-temperature and high-pressure conditions. The lubricant ensures easy disassembly and maintenance of machinery, reducing downtime and operational costs. It also protects metal components from rust and corrosion, extending their lifespan. In addition, the product is vital in applications involving extreme environments, such as marine and industrial settings, where metal parts are exposed to moisture, salt, and other corrosive elements. Its versatility and protective qualities make it indispensable in ensuring the reliability and efficiency of equipment. Copper-based anti-seize lubricants dominate the market due to their excellent thermal and electrical conductivity, making them ideal for high-temperature applications in industrial machinery and automotive sectors. Aluminum-based variants are gaining traction owing to their corrosion resistance and cost-effectiveness, especially in marine and outdoor environments. Nickel-based lubricants are preferred for their stability in extreme conditions, while ceramic-based formulations are emerging as niche segments for specialized high-temperature and high-pressure applications. Market size estimates suggest that copper-based anti-seize lubricants account for approximately 55-60% of the total market, with aluminum-based products capturing around 20-25%, and the remaining share split between nickel and ceramic variants. The fastest-growing segment within the Japan market is the ceramic-based anti-seize lubricants, projected to grow at a CAGR of approximately 7-8% over the next five years. This growth is driven by increasing demand for high-performance lubricants in aerospace, power generation, and advanced manufacturing sectors, where extreme operational conditions necessitate innovative solutions. The market for traditional copper and aluminum-based variants is reaching maturity, characterized by steady but slower growth rates of around 2-3% annually. Japan Metal Anti-Seize Lubricant Market By Application Segment Analysis The application landscape for metal anti-seize lubricants in Japan encompasses diverse sectors, including automotive, industrial machinery, aerospace, power generation, and marine. Automotive applications remain the largest segment, accounting for approximately 40-45% of total demand, driven by vehicle manufacturing, maintenance, and assembly processes where anti-seize compounds prevent galling, corrosion, and seizure of threaded components. Industrial machinery applications constitute around 30%, particularly in manufacturing plants, power plants, and heavy equipment maintenance, where high-temperature and corrosion-resistant lubricants are critical. Aerospace applications, although representing a smaller share (around 10-12%), are experiencing rapid growth due to increasing aircraft maintenance and manufacturing activities, emphasizing the need for high-performance, specialized lubricants. Marine and power generation segments are also expanding, driven by infrastructure modernization and stringent safety standards, with an estimated combined share of 15-18%. The fastest-growing application segment is aerospace, projected to expand at a CAGR of approximately 6-7% over the next five years. This growth is fueled by Japan’s expanding aerospace manufacturing sector and increased aircraft fleet maintenance, requiring advanced anti-seize solutions capable of withstanding extreme conditions.
